Marvel Studios has revealed a new trailer for ‘Deadpool & Wolverine,’ which teases the return of Doctor Strange or at least one sorcerer from the multiverse. It also shows multiple variants of Wolverine.


The trailer begins with Logan sitting down in a bar (the scene has a resemblance to Wolverine's cameo in X-Men: First Class) as Deadpool says hi and asks Wolverine to come with him. Both of them continue bickering and later Deadpool explains why he needed him. The trailer includes some footage from the previous trailer, but it includes many new scenes. The trailer also shows multiple variants of Wolverine as well as a giant head of Ant-Man. At the end of the trailer, Deadpool and Wolverine jump together in a portal that seems to be opened by Doctor Strange or one of his sorcerers.


Shawn Levy directs DEADPOOL & WOLVERINE which stars Ryan Reynolds, Hugh Jackman, Emma Corrin, Morena Baccarin, Jennifer Garner as Elektra, Brianna Hildebrand, Shioli Kutsuna, Karan Soni, Matthew Macfadyen, Leslie Uggams, Rob Delaney, and Stefan Kapicic among others.

Kevin Feige, Ryan Reynolds, Shawn Levy, and Lauren Shuler Donner produce with Louis D’Esposito, Wendy Jacobson, Mary McLaglen, Josh McLaglen, Rhett Reese, Paul Wernick, George Dewey, Simon Kinberg, and Jonathon Komack Martin serving as executive producers. DEADPOOL & WOLVERINE is written by Ryan Reynolds & Rhett Reese & Paul Wernick & Zeb Wells & Shawn Levy.


Marvel Studios’ DEADPOOL & WOLVERINE opens in U.S. & Canadian movie theaters on July 26, 2024, and will be available in IMAX, RealD 3D, Dolby Cinema, 4DX, Cinemark XD, and premium screens everywhere.


The revealed images had already teased that the plot will follow the story of Multiverse introducing us to the Deadpool Corps, a multi-dimensional team of alternate reality Deadpools. Like every other thing in the Multiverse, Deadpool also has many variants, and the variants shown in the images are Dogpool, Knightpool, and the original Deadpool from the FOX universe. In the comics, Deadpool Corps also included Lady Deadpool, Kidpool, Headpool, Pandapool, Grootpool, Motorpool, Squirrelpool, Hawkeyepool, and others. MCU doesn't have any Deadpool in the present universe, but there could be another Deadpool from the X-Men universe who was last seen in X-Men Origins: Wolverine.
